Incorporating Telemedicine into Care at a Large Urban HIV Clinic

Description

Access to telemedicine visits in a multidisciplinary urban HIV clinic allows for improved access to care for patients who have fallen out of care or those who have difficulty attending their appointments due to stigma, multiple comorbidities, or barriers related to work, transportation, or childcare.

Learning Objectives

  1. Describe the implementation of a telemedicine program in an urban HIV clinic to improve access to care.
  2. Discuss patient-level barriers to telemedicine.
  3. Discuss provider-level barriers to telemedicine.
